A leading energy provider in Greater London is looking for Smart Meter Quality Inspectors to ensure that smart metering services adhere to high safety and compliance standards.

Candidates should have dual fuel qualifications, strong technical knowledge, and experience in incident investigations.

This field-based role offers a salary of £40,988 per annum and includes potential bonuses and a range of customizable benefits.

The position supports career development in a culture valuing diversity and inclusion.

How to prepare for a job interview at EDF Energy

Know Your Stuff

Make sure you brush up on your technical knowledge about smart metering systems. Understand the compliance standards and safety regulations that are crucial for this role. Being able to discuss these topics confidently will show the interviewer that you're serious about the position.

Showcase Your Experience

Prepare specific examples from your past work where you've dealt with incident investigations or ensured compliance.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ers. This will help you demonstrate your relevant experience effectively.

Ask Smart Questions

Interviews are a two-way street! Prepare thoughtful questions about the company’s approach to safety and compliance in smart metering. This not only shows your interest but also helps you gauge if the company culture aligns with your values.
